In-Store Activities
As a sales representative, you can prepare for the day using the appointments and accounts pages. Your mobile application facilitates viewing of appointments visits with a guided tasks list without checking in to an appointment. You can do the following in-store activities:
-
Inventory Audit: Perform inventory audits to update shelf stock, placement, and so on.
-
Account and Promotion Compliance Audit Surveys: Capture entries for accounts and promotions using surveys.
-
Promotion Presentation: Present promotions at the retail stores and add the promotions to the shopping cart to enhance sales.
-
Order Delivery: You can deliver shipments for orders and collect payments, print receipts, and so on.
Supplementary Activities
Use the Main menu to get a quick view of the features that you can use in your application without having to check in to a route or an appointment. You can perform synchronization, edit the settings, view and reload your inventory, and so on. Some of the key supporting activities that you can perform for an appointment during your store visit are:
-
Shopping Cart: Order products, view order history, order details, and capture signature for orders.
-
Notes: Capture notes using speech for follow-up details of the store.
-
Photos: Take pictures on the move to support in-store tasks and promotion activities besides using automated store binders and attachments.
-
Product Assortments: Use product assortments and planograms to leverage your sales.
-
Merchandising Materials: Share merchandising materials and planograms with the retail stores.
-
Store Binders: Use store binders to view marketing content.
